The Importance Of Water Fire Fighting Equipment For Effective Fire Suppression

When a fire breaks out, having the right equipment to combat the flames is crucial. water fire fighting equipment plays a vital role in the firefighting process, as water is one of the most commonly used agents to extinguish fires. From fire hoses to hydrants, water fire fighting equipment plays a crucial role in ensuring that fires are quickly and effectively brought under control.

One of the most common types of water fire fighting equipment is the fire hose. These hoses are designed to deliver water at high pressure to the source of the fire, allowing firefighters to quickly extinguish flames. Fire hoses are typically made of durable materials such as rubber or nylon to withstand the pressure of the water flow. They are also available in various lengths to reach different areas of a building or outdoor space.

Another essential piece of water fire fighting equipment is the fire hydrant. Fire hydrants are strategically placed throughout cities and towns to provide firefighters with easy access to water. When a fire breaks out, firefighters can quickly connect hoses to the nearest hydrant to access a large water supply. Fire hydrants are equipped with valves that can be opened to release water, allowing firefighters to quickly douse flames and prevent the fire from spreading.

In addition to fire hoses and hydrants, water fire fighting equipment also includes fire pumps. Fire pumps are used to boost the pressure of water from a hydrant or other water source to ensure that firefighters have an adequate supply of water to extinguish the fire. These pumps are typically mounted on fire trucks and can deliver hundreds of gallons of water per minute to the scene of the fire. Fire pumps are essential for ensuring that firefighters have the water they need to quickly and effectively suppress fires.

water fire fighting equipment also includes fire nozzles, which are attached to the end of fire hoses to control the flow of water. Fire nozzles come in various sizes and shapes to deliver water in a wide spray or a concentrated stream, depending on the needs of the firefighters. Fire nozzles are an essential tool for firefighters, as they allow them to direct water precisely where it is needed to extinguish the flames.

In addition to these essential pieces of water fire fighting equipment, firefighters may also use water tanks and portable water tanks to store and transport water to the scene of a fire. Water tanks are typically mounted on fire trucks and can hold large quantities of water to ensure that firefighters have an adequate supply to combat the flames. Portable water tanks are also used in remote areas where access to water may be limited, allowing firefighters to bring water with them to the scene of a fire.
